Chinese GP promoters aiming to postpone race

The promoters of the Chinese Grand Prix are looking to postpone the race and have it take place later in the year instead. After the race was cancelled in 2020 due to the global pandemic, the plan was for it to return early on in the 2021 campaign. Specifically, it was chosen to be the third race of the season and is scheduled to take place on April 11. However, with the number of COVID-19 cases rising throughout the world and global restrictions being upped, promoters are in discussions with the sport about postponing it.
